What is a Crypto Online Casino?
At its core, a crypto online casino is a betting platform that accepts cryptocurrencies-- such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), and Litecoin (LTC)-- as a main approach for deposits, withdrawals, and gameplay. Unlike traditional online casinos that depend on fiat currency banking systems (credit cards, bank wires, or PayPal), crypto casinos use blockchain technology to help with fund transfers.
This technological shift gets rid of the need for third-party intermediaries, such as business banks, which typically impose rigorous restrictions, high costs, and prolonged processing times on gambling-related deals.
Why Players Are Switching to Crypto
The rise of the crypto casino is not simply a pattern; it is driven by a number of distinct advantages that enhance the user experience compared to traditional platforms.
1. Enhanced Anonymity
Many crypto gambling establishments run with "no-KYC" (Know Your Customer) policies, permitting users to register and start playing without submitting government-issued identification or proof-of-residence files. This privacy-centric approach appeals to gamers who value discretion.
2. Quick Transaction Speeds
In standard gambling, a withdrawal might take 3 to five organization days to clear through a bank. With cryptocurrency, deals are processed on the blockchain, typically leading to withdrawals hitting the user's personal wallet within minutes or hours.
3. International Accessibility
Cryptocurrency is borderless. Users in regions where traditional banking organizations limit gambling-related deals frequently find that crypto gambling establishments stay available, supplied they comply with regional laws.
4. Provably Fair Gaming
This is possibly the most significant innovation in the sector. Crypto casinos typically include "Provably Fair" algorithms. This allows the player to validate the fairness of every individual bet through cryptographic hashing, guaranteeing that the casino has not tampered with the outcome of a video game.

Crypto casinos use the same range of games discovered in brick-and-mortar or conventional online casinos, however with added layers of technological performance.
- Slots: The most popular classification, including thousands of themes-- from ancient mythology to modern popular culture-- integrated with top quality graphics and fluid animation.
- Table Games: Digital versions of Blackjack, Baccarat, Roulette, and Poker.
- Live Dealer Games: Real-time streaming of expert dealers running games from a studio, bridging the space in between land-based casinos and online alternatives.
- Crypto-Exclusive "Crash" Games: Pioneered by the crypto community, these video games involve a multiplier that ticks upward, with players having to squander before the game "crashes."
Best Practices for Crypto Gambling
Security is critical when dealing with digital properties. Whether a user is a newbie or a veteran, the following practices ought to be standard protocol:
- Use Hardware Wallets: Never keep big amounts of cryptocurrency on the casino platform itself. Utilize a non-custodial wallet (like Ledger or Trezor) to hold your funds.
-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Always allow 2FA on both your crypto exchange and your casino account. This adds a crucial layer of security versus unauthorized access.
- Examine Licensing: Even in the crypto world, track record matters. Search for casinos accredited in reputable jurisdictions (such as Curacao or Costa Rica) to guarantee they follow basic security procedures.
- Start Small: Test the platform's withdrawal process with a percentage of cryptocurrency before depositing big stakes.
Prospective Risks to Consider
While crypto gambling establishments offer numerous advantages, it is essential to acknowledge the intrinsic dangers:
- Market Volatility: The worth of crypto assets can vary hugely. A jackpot win could lose considerable fiat worth if the cost of the hidden currency drops suddenly.
- Absence of Recourse: Because blockchain transactions are permanent, if a gamer sends out funds to the wrong address, the money is typically unrecoverable.
- Regulative Uncertainty: The legal landscape for crypto gambling is developing. Users need to guarantee they are not violating any regional or nationwide laws regarding digital asset use.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Are crypto casinos legal?
The legality of crypto gambling establishments depends heavily on your jurisdiction. Some nations have actually explicitly legalized and controlled them, while others restrict them completely. Always check your regional laws before taking part.
How do I deposit funds into a crypto casino?
You should initially have a cryptocurrency wallet (such as MetaMask or Trust Wallet). From there, you send out the preferred quantity of crypto to the distinct wallet address provided by the casino throughout the deposit stage.
Is it possible to lose my winnings?
Yes, betting involves threat. However, with "Provably Fair" games, you can confirm that the casino is not cheating, guaranteeing that your https://jsbin.com/?html,output losses or wins are the outcome of true randomness.
Do crypto gambling establishments use perks?
Yes. In reality, numerous crypto gambling establishments provide considerably higher bonuses-- often in the form of Bitcoin or Ethereum-- than conventional casinos, as a way to bring in new users to the platform.
Can I withdraw my winnings in fiat currency?
The majority of crypto gambling establishments handle deals exclusively in crypto. To convert your jackpots into fiat (e.g., GBP, EUR), you will require to move your earnings from the casino to a crypto exchange, where you can offer the coins for your local currency.
